The Claiming (Last Resort #2) by Jasmine Warga, - ADVISABLE

The Claiming (Last Resort #2) by Jasmine Warga, 240 pages. Scholastic, 2026. $18

Language: G (4 swears, 0 ‘f’); Mature Content: G; Violence: PG (ghosts and specters)

BUYING ADVISORY: EL, MS - ADVISABLE

APPEALS TO: SEVERAL

7th grader Teddy and his new friends Lila and Caleb defeated the Fire Maiden and sent her back to the Other Side where she belongs -- right? Then why has Lila started flickering? Sometimes she’s there and sometimes she isn’t. And the flickering is getting worse. Tedy has received some help and advice from his friends on the Phantom Hunter forum, especially Rosteen, who knows an awful lot about the spirit world. Turns out the Fire Maiden is gaining in strength - helped along by the seances the kids at their school are holding to summon her.  If the Fire Maiden isn’t stopped, Lila may be lost forever.

The Claiming is written by a different author in the same universe and with the same characters as Erin Entrada Kelly’s original. The Fire Maiden is just as creepy and introducing the seances ups the creep factor.  Neither Lila nor Teddy are confident enough to tell the popular kids to stop their nonsense, so the final scenes in the resort are delightfully stressful and creepy. 

The characters cue white.
